Level 3 Green Skills Implementation of Building Information
As the Construction and Built Environment industry moves into a new technological era, it is essential that people working in the industry enhance their digital skills. Building Information Modelling (BIM) involves creating and using intelligent 3D models to develop and communicate project decisions. It’s a whole new way of working, and it is predicated that within a decade it will be integral to the construction industry.
This course focuses on building and design of a building, the skills gained will enable candidates to asses how renewable energy and modern methods of construction can be entwined into the planning stage of the building.

Wakefield College
Wakefield College is a large, general further education college based on two campuses in central Wakefield and Castleford. The college aims to promote social mobility and improve life chances by providing education and training opportunities for all. The college works with a range of local partners to contribute to the wider prosperity, economy and regeneration of the area.
